Description
This 5-Minute Raw Carrot Salad is a refreshing, tangy, and naturally sweet dish made from fresh carrots, a zesty dressing of apple cider vinegar, lime juice, and raw honey, and finished with a sprinkle of sesame seeds and cilantro. It’s quick to prepare, perfect as a light side salad or a healthy snack.
Ingredients

Dressing
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
- 1 tablespoon lime juice
- 1 tablespoon raw honey
- ½ teaspoon flaky sea salt
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
Salad
- 2 large carrots, peeled (organic preferred)
- ¼ bunch cilantro leaves
- 1 teaspoon sesame seeds
- 1 pinch flaky sea salt
Instructions
- Prepare the carrots: Peel the carrots thoroughly and then grate or julienne them into thin, even strips. This ensures they absorb the dressing well and have a pleasant texture.
- Make the dressing: In a bowl, whisk together the apple cider vinegar, lime juice, raw honey, flaky sea salt, and olive oil until fully combined and emulsified, creating a balanced, tangy-sweet dressing.
- Toss the salad: Add the grated carrots and the cilantro leaves into the bowl with the dressing. Toss everything together gently but thoroughly, ensuring the carrots are evenly coated.
- Finish with toppings: Sprinkle the salad with sesame seeds and an extra pinch of flaky sea salt for added texture and flavor enhancement. Serve immediately for the freshest taste.
Notes
- For best results, use organic carrots to maximize freshness and flavor.
- You can substitute lime juice with lemon juice if lime is unavailable.
- Adjust the sweetness by adding more or less raw honey according to taste preferences.
- This salad is best eaten fresh but can be refrigerated for up to 24 hours in an airtight container.
- To make this dish vegan, ensure your honey is replaced with a plant-based sweetener like maple syrup.
